Mauro Tassotti warns Milan will “need to be very aggressive” against PSV in the Champions League play-off.

The assistant manager to Massimiliano Allegri spoke to Milan Channel about Tuesday’s difficult trip to Eindhoven.

“All of our pre-season preparation has been aimed at this crucial game for the Champions League play-off,” said Tassotti.

“We played the friendly games that we considered suitable, though of course this is not the same as playing a friendly or in Serie A.

“PSV are a team who keep the ball very well and know how to attack, so we will need to be very aggressive.

“Their stadium isn’t very big, but it is a passionate atmosphere and the enthusiasm will make it difficult for us. We haven’t had much time to study PSV, as we only began tactical discussions on Friday.

“The only doubts we have are wrapped up in the stamina and intensity, as obviously this is our first ‘real’ match of the season and it was tough to play at a high tempo in America with that heat.

“Now Tuesday’s game is the only thing in our minds. We hope to get a good result, as getting through is fundamental for many reasons.”
